Koolcube began in the beverage industry — carbonation and nitrogenation systems, where a couple of degrees and a couple of millilitres change how a drink tastes.
Working on those systems makes you fussy about two things: temperature and purity. You learn how much of a drink's character sits in the temperature it is served at, and how quickly that character disappears when something dilutes it.
Then came the part that was harder to ignore. Working alongside researchers at the University of Queensland, we kept running into the same subject: what is actually in water, and by extension, what is actually in ice. Microplastics. Pollutants. Whatever was in the tray before. Ice is the one ingredient nobody inspects, and it goes into almost every cold drink anyone pours.
So we made the opposite of ice
A cube of 304 food-grade stainless steel, sealed, with an ultra-smooth electropolished finish. It has no pores, so nothing collects in it and nothing leaches out of it. It chills a drink on contact and holds that temperature for about half an hour. And when it is done, it goes in the dishwasher and then back in the freezer.
It also stops the other quiet waste: buying ice, over and over, in a plastic bag, for a product that is 90% water and gone the same evening.
